1

NH88 : Your Gaming Hub

marleyvebb370041
Dive into a world of thrilling adventures and competitive excitement with NH88, your ultimate gaming destination. Whether a seasoned veteran or a curious newcomer, NH88 offers a vast library of games to satisfy every https://pnh88.com/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story